They are both common and have no value. The first one is a regular #300. There is a variation of that stamp that is valuable, but it’s a coil version, not this perforated version from a booklet which is what you have. I made a video about this stamp https://youtu.be/tSUU8ru4zvA

The other stamp is also common and has no value. Looks to be either a #335. There is a valuable example of this design, but it’s on bluish paper. I can’t tell from the photo, but its very rare, whereas the #335 is not, so it’s 99.99% likely you have the common one with no value.
